You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*/package org.apache.pluto.util.assemble.ear;import java.io.FilterOutputStream;import java.io.IOException;import java.io.OutputStream;import java.util.zip.CRC32;import java.util.zip.Checksum;/** * Used as a temporary container for assembled bytes, and for tracking * metadata specific to <code>JarEntry</code> objects, especially the * size of the <code>JarEntry</code> and its checksum. */abstract class AssemblySink extends FilterOutputStream { /** * The default buffer length used when reading and * writing to the sink. By default the value is * 4096 bytes. */ protected static int DEFAULT_BUFLEN = 4 * 1024; // 4kb /** * The CRC-32 calculator. */ protected final Checksum CRC = new CRC32(); /** * The number of bytes written to the sink. */ protected long count = 0; /** * Constructs a sink with <i>null</i> as an * underlying output stream. */ AssemblySink( ) { super(null); } /** * Constructs a sink with <i>out</i> as the * underlying output stream. Method calls * on the sink are delegated to the underlying * output stream. * * @param out the underlying output stream. */ AssemblySink( OutputStream out ) { super(out); } /** * Obtain the number of bytes written to the sink. * * @return the number of bytes written to the sink */ long getByteCount() { return count; } /** * Obtain the checksum of the bytes written to * the sink to this point. * * @return the CRC-32 checksum of the bytes in the sink */ long getCrc() { return CRC.getValue(); } /** * Write out the bytes in the sink to the supplied * output stream, using the default buffer length. * * @param out the OutputStream the sink should be copied to. * @throws IOException */ void writeTo( OutputStream out ) throws IOException { writeTo( out, DEFAULT_BUFLEN ); } /** * Write out the bytes in the sink to the supplied * output stream, using the supplied buffer length. * * @param out the OutputStream the sink should be copied to. * @param buflen the buffer length used when copying bytes * @throws IOException */ abstract void writeTo( OutputStream out, int buflen ) throws IOException; public synchronized void write(byte[] b) throws IOException { try { out.write(b); count++; CRC.update( b, 0, b.length ); } catch (IOException e) { count = 0; CRC.reset(); throw e; } } public synchronized void write(byte[] b, int off, int len) throws IOException { try { out.write(b, off, len); count += len; CRC.update(b, off, len); } catch (IOException e) { count = 0; CRC.reset(); throw e; } } public synchronized void write(int b) throws IOException { try { out.write(b); count++; CRC.update(b); } catch (IOException e) { count = 0; CRC.reset(); throw e; } } /** * Closes the underlying output stream, resets the * checksum calculator, and clears the byte count. */ public void close() throws IOException { try { out.close(); } finally { CRC.reset(); count = 0; } }}
